Empire Day, celebrated on May 24th, was an annual observance in the British Empire to commemorate Queen Victoria's birthday and to promote a sense of loyalty and connection to the empire. In Sheffield, the day was marked with various festivities, including this impressive display of the Union Jack at Bramall Lane.
